/** Fraction at which the in-app bars are considered fully settled into the hidden edge. */
private const val STATUS_BAR_HIDE_THRESHOLD = 0.999f
/**
* Hides the OS status bar once the in-app bars have settled into the hidden edge, and shows it the
* moment they start coming back. The OS status bar is binary (cannot slide), so it is driven off the
* collapse fraction with a near-1 threshold, which means it toggles on settle rather than mid-drag.
*
* Only the top status bar is touched; the bottom OS navigation bar is left alone.
* BEHAVIOR_SHOW_TRANSIENT_BARS_BY_SWIPE lets the user swipe to peek the status bar while immersed.
* The status bar is always restored on dispose so leaving an immersive screen can never strand a
* hidden bar.
*/
@Composable
private fun ImmersiveStatusBarEffect(state: DisappearingBarState) {
val view = LocalView.current
if (view.isInEditMode) return
val window = getActivityWindow() ?: return
val controller = remember(window, view) { WindowInsetsControllerCompat(window, view) }
LaunchedEffect(controller, state) {
snapshotFlow {
max(state.topCollapsedFraction, state.bottomCollapsedFraction) >= STATUS_BAR_HIDE_THRESHOLD
}.distinctUntilChanged()
.collect { shouldHide ->
controller.systemBarsBehavior =
WindowInsetsControllerCompat.BEHAVIOR_SHOW_TRANSIENT_BARS_BY_SWIPE
if (shouldHide) {
controller.hide(WindowInsetsCompat.Type.statusBars())
} else {
controller.show(WindowInsetsCompat.Type.statusBars())
}
}
}
DisposableEffect(controller) {
onDispose { controller.show(WindowInsetsCompat.Type.statusBars()) }
}
}
